- Engage Your Core: Provides stability and reduces risk of injury.
- Bend at the Knees: Utilizes leg strength to minimize back strain.
- Keep the Load Close: Enhances balance and reduces leverage on the body.
- Feet Shoulder-Width Apart: Creates a solid base for increased support.
- Maintain a Neutral Spine: Encourages proper posture during lifting.
- Lift Slowly and Controlled: Prevents injury through deliberate movements.
- Use Assistive Devices: Alleviates lifting strain, promoting better body mechanics.
- Take Regular Breaks: Reduces fatigue and maintains performance.
- Stretch Before Lifting: Enhances flexibility and prepares muscles for effort.
- Practice Mindfulness: Stay aware of body mechanics during lifting activities.

The Role of Core Strengthening
One of the fundamental aspects of leveraging effective lifting methods is engaging the core. Strengthening abdominal muscles provides stability and reduces the risk of injuries when lifting heavy objects. Incorporating upper back pain exercises into your routine can mitigate the adverse effects of poor lifting practices. Consider exercises such as pelvic tilts and planks to enhance core stability and support posture correction.
Incorporating Trunk Exercises
In addressing upper back pain, incorporating trunk exercises into daily routines is invaluable. Specific exercises like seated rows and dumbbell pullovers target the upper back muscles while promoting improved posture. These exercises not only provide relief from pain but also enhance overall muscle tone, significantly affecting how individuals carry out daily activities. Simple modifications, such as using an ergonomic backpack, can additionally alleviate stress associated with carrying loads improperly.
Mindful Lifting Strategies
To minimize strain while lifting, it is essential to adopt mindful strategies. Maintain a neutral spine, keep loads close to your body, and use your legs to lift by bending at the knees. These modifications help prevent injuries linked to stress and upper back pain. Regular breaks during prolonged lifting tasks can significantly contribute to reducing overall fatigue and maintaining performance.

Mechanism of Action
TAGMED’s neurovertebral decompression applies a controlled, progressive traction force to the spine. This innovative method increases the space between vertebrae, effectively reducing pressure on intervertebral discs and nerve roots. Additionally, it promotes better fluid circulation in the targeted area, which helps lower inflammation and relieve pain. This non-invasive solution is especially effective for individuals suffering from chronic back issues and can significantly improve overall well-being.

Frequently Asked Questions
Dorsal Pain
- When should I see a doctor for mid-back pain?If pain lasts more than a few weeks, worsens, or is accompanied by fever, weight loss, or neurological problems, seek medical advice.
- Quels sports peuvent soulager la douleur dorsale ?La natation, le yoga, le Pilates et la marche sont souvent recommandés car ils améliorent la mobilité et renforcent les muscles du dos.
- Is mid-back pain related to osteoporosis?Yes, osteoporosis increases the risk of vertebral fractures, which can lead to persistent mid-back pain.
- Does smoking affect mid-back pain?Yes, smoking reduces blood flow to discs and muscles, increasing the risk of back pain.
- La douleur dorsale est-elle liée à une inflammation ?Certaines douleurs dorsales sont dues à une inflammation des muscles, des ligaments ou des articulations vertébrales.
- Quel rôle joue l’ergonomie dans la prévention de la douleur dorsale ?Une ergonomie adaptée (chaise, bureau, écran à bonne hauteur) aide à maintenir une posture correcte, réduisant ainsi les tensions sur le dos.
- Is physical therapy recommended for mid-back pain?Yes, a physical therapist can provide targeted exercises, stretches, and manual techniques to ease pain.
- La douleur dorsale est-elle plus fréquente chez les personnes âgées ?Avec l’âge, les disques s’usent, la musculature s’affaiblit et l’arthrose peut se développer, ce qui augmente le risque de douleurs dorsales.
- Do high heels cause mid-back pain?Yes, high heels alter spine alignment and may cause tension in the back.
- Quelles sont les causes courantes de douleur dorsale ?Les causes incluent une mauvaise posture, des tensions musculaires, des blessures, l’arthrose, des troubles de la colonne vertébrale ou le stress.
